Streamline Space in Your North Face Backpack
Rocking a large North Face backpack? Awesome! But even the best packs can get overstuffed. Don't stress – with a few smart strategies, you can easily maximize your space and keep your gear organized. First, arrange heavier items at the base for better weight distribution. Then, use compartments strategically to categorize your belongings. Don't forget about compression straps – these are your secret weapons when it comes to compacting bulk.
- Fold up soft items like clothing to free up precious space.
- Utilize unused spaces – stuff socks into shoes or nestle smaller items in larger ones.
- Leave behind unnecessary belongings. You'd be surprised how much heft you can shed by being mindful about what you pack.
